This creamy 4-ingredient peanut butter blueberry banana smoothie makes the perfect healthy breakfast or snack. Top this easy blueberry banana smoothie with your favorite granola, extra banana slices and blueberries, and a drizzle of peanut butter! Options to add extra protein or sneak in veggies, too.

Instructions
Add all ingredients to a blender and blend until smooth. Top with granola, a drizzle of peanut butter and extra frozen or fresh blueberries and banana slices. Serves 1. Double the recipe to serve 2.
Notes
Feel free to add 1 scoop of protein powder of choice or ½ cup plain greek yogurt for a boost of protein.
